Pollock Twins Reincarnation
After Joanna and Jacqueline Pollock died in a 1957 car crash, their mother gave birth to twins Jennifer and Gillian. The twins recognized their dead sisters' toys, had matching birthmarks, and showed phobias of cars. Reincarnation researcher Ian Stevenson documented the case.
